What is the climate like in northern Mexico?

Social Studies
1 answer:
Stella [2.4K]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

n inland northern Mexico, the weather is generally arid and varies a great deal throughout the year. During the summer months, it can be very hot, with an average high over 90-degrees in August. Temperatures drop in winter, with north winds bringing a chill, January sees an average low of 48-degree

In Ivan Pavlov's famous studies, the _____ was the unconditioned stimulus, and the _____ was the unconditioned response.
mr Goodwill [35]

Answer:

In Ivan Pavlov's famous studies, the food was the unconditioned stimulus, and the salivation was the unconditioned response.

Explanation:

Ivan Pavlov (1849-1936) was a Russian physiologist who conducted studies on behavior conditioning with dogs. In his studies, dogs would learn to associate different stimuli and produce certain responses.

A unconditioned stimulus is something that produces a natural, automatic response. That natural response is called unconditioned response. In Pavlov's studies with the dogs, he would show them food, and the dogs would start salivating because of it. That means the unconditioned stimulus was the food, and the unconditional response was the salivation.
